About Northside Talus Leather Hiking Shoes - Waterproof (For Men)
Closeouts. Don't let that shallow creek bed stand in your way -- continue on the trail with these waterproof Northside Talus hiking shoes! Not only do they completely block moisture, but they lend extra cushioning and comfort for long days on your feet, and the sturdy leather upper protects your toes from all the hazards on the trail.
- Waterproof breathable membrane
- Smooth leather upper with mesh inlays for breathability
- Synthetic toe and heel wrap for hazard protection and improved stability
- Ghillie-style lacing provides a secure fit
- Gusseted tongue keeps out dirt and debris
- Moisture-wicking mesh lining
- Removable cushioned insole with arch support
- Shock-absorbing EVA midsole for lightweight, flexible comfort
- Oil- and slip-resistant lugged rubber outsole provides excellent traction on varied terrain

Specs
Specs about Northside Talus Leather Hiking Shoes - Waterproof (For Men)
- Waterproof (All)
- Waterproof materials: Waterproof breathable membrane
- Gusseted tongue
- Upper: Leather and synthetic
- Lining: Fabric
- Removable insole
- Slip-resistant :Yes
- Outsole: Synthetic
- Heel height: 1-1/4"
- Weight (pair): 1 lb. 14 oz.
- All specs based on size 10
